Wilder vs Stiverne is watched by 824,000 viewers
Andrew Karlov
Nov. 7, 2017, 2:56 p.m.

Heavyweight titleholder Deontay Wilder’s electrifying, three-knockdown, first-round knockout of former titlist Bermane Stiverne in a rematch Saturday night at Barclays Center in Brooklyn, New York, averaged a strong 824,000 viewers for the live airing on Showtime, according to Nielsen Media Research. The 2 minute, 59 second fight peaked at 887,000.

Wladimir Klitschko was considered as a candidate for the post AIBA president
Andrew Karlov
Nov. 7, 2017, 9:11 a.m.

Former world boxing champion and Olympic champion Wladimir Klitschko was considered as a candidate for the post of president of the International Boxing Association (AIBA). This information was presented to the members of the executive committee of AIBA at a meeting held last weekend in Dubai.
